Transaction 41d7337101d1fa275153c0849617af625c280b1763c88c5451acbe268493b9a3
1 Input
1 Output
-
41d7337101d1fa275153c0849617af625c280b1763c88c5451acbe268493b9a3:0
- value
- 548437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61a937eb11aaaf3a356a2b1a2838ed82d5dc171e OP_EQUAL
- address
- 3AbQBetGKZFY1SnRe6f4TX2cRzyVBHzYKS